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Worcestershire Parkway to Colchester Town start from as little as £28.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Worcestershire Parkway to Colchester Town start from £71.50 one way, or £71.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Worcestershire Parkway to Colchester Town are available for £70.00 one way, or £140.00 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Discover Worcestershire Parkway Train Station

Nestled in the heart of England, Worcestershire Parkway Train Station serves as a pivotal transport hub in the West Midlands. Opened relatively recently in February 2020, this modern station was designed to ease transport connectivity within the northwest-southeast mainline axis and improve access to rail services for the surrounding county. With its strategic location and excellent facilities, Worcestershire Parkway is an ideal choice for local commuters and travelers bound for various destinations across the UK.

Facilities and Amenities at Worcestershire Parkway

When you step into Worcestershire Parkway, you'll immediately notice its focus on accessibility and convenience. The station features step-free access throughout, ensuring it is welcoming to all travelers. Ticketing options are flexible, offering both a staffed ticket office and user-friendly machines, including accessible ones. Although waiting room facilities are absent, there is ample seating available for a comfortable wait.

Additional services include helpful staff at the ticket office and customer help points, who are ready to assist from early morning till late evening. CCTV coverage assures safety, while free parking for blue badge holders emphasizes inclusive services. For cyclists, there are 52 cycling spaces equipped with CCTV, ensuring security for those commuting on two wheels.

Onward Travel Options

Worcestershire Parkway is a gateway to seamless travel, with excellent integration with other modes of transportation. A bus stop and a taxi stand right at the station's front ease your onward journey. If you're planning a trip further afield, consider the X50 bus route, connecting Worcester to Evesham via Pershore - a perfect day trip opportunity.

Facilities and Amenities at Colchester Town Station

Colchester Town Station is set up to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ey for all travelers.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 20:15 on weekdays and slightly shorter hours on Saturdays, providing ample opportunity for passengers to purchase and collect tickets. There's no need to worry if you’re catching an early or late train, as ticket machines are available around the clock, and they even support smartcard validators.

For those requiring assistance, station staff are on hand to offer help and support during ticket office hours. There are also help points and screens to keep you informed about departures. Notably, the station offers step-free access, making it easy for everyone to navigate, and it's equipped with an induction loop for those with hearing impairments.

Need a quick refreshment before you board? Stop by the 'Steam' kiosk for a coffee and snack. Free parking is available at a local council-managed car park, minus accessible spaces, but if you're arriving by bike, there are sheltered stands for safe storage. Unfortunately, the station doesn’t offer luggage storage or accessible toilets, but basic toilet facilities are available during select hours.

Travel Connections at Colchester Town

Stepping out of Colchester Town Station, you'll discover various transport links to continue your journey. It’s only a five-minute walk to the Colchester Bus Station. When there are engineering works or service disruptions, the local bus services, including routes 61, 62, 65, and 66, accept rail tickets to help passengers reach alternative nearby stations. Just keep an eye out for the replacement bus stop near the Magistrates' Court if you need a shuttle due to planned engineering works.
